The Shining is a 1980 horror film directed by Stanley Kubrick and starring Jack Nicholson, Shelley Duvall and Danny Lloyd. The film follows the Torrence family, Jack (Nicholson), Wendy (Duvall) and their son, Danny (Lloyd) as they move into the Overlook Hotel, deep in the Colorado Rockies, to serve as its winter caretakers. Jack's job is to maintain the hotel while the rest of the family is in charge of the day-to-day operations. He quickly becomes overwhelmed by the isolation and the pressure of being alone with his family, and soon begins to experience visions of ghosts from the past. As Jack's behavior becomes increasingly erratic, Danny discovers that he has a special gift — he can sense the presence of the supernatural. As the family's lives become increasingly threatened by the mysterious forces in the hotel, Danny's visions help them escape from the hotel before it's too late.

The Innocents, directed by Jack Clayton and released in 1961, is a psychological thriller based on Henry James' novella, The Turn of the Screw. The film follows a young governess, Miss Giddens (Deborah Kerr), as she takes on a position at a remote country estate to look after two recently orphaned children, Miles and Flora. As she grows closer to the children and their strange behavior, Miss Giddens begins to suspect their home may be haunted by a malevolent presence. As the story progresses, Miss Giddens must confront her own fears and doubts as she discovers the truth of the haunting and attempts to protect the children from the evil forces that seem to be lurking in the shadows.

The Others is a 2001 supernatural horror mystery film written and directed by Alejandro Amenábar. It stars Nicole Kidman as Grace Stewart, a woman who lives in an old house on the English Channel island of Jersey with her two photosensitive children, Anne and Nicholas. After a series of strange occurrences, Grace comes to believe that the house is haunted by the spirits of three dead soldiers and hires a trio of servants to help to look after her children. As the story unfolds, Grace discovers the truth behind her family's disturbing past and is forced to confront the secrets that she and her children have been keeping. The Others is a chilling exploration of trust, faith, and the supernatural, with a twist ending that will leave viewers guessing until the very end.

The Conjuring is a 2013 supernatural horror film directed by James Wan. It stars Vera Farmiga and Patrick Wilson as Ed and Lorraine Warren, paranormal investigators and authors associated with prominent cases of haunting. The Warrens come to the assistance of the Perron family, who are experiencing increasingly disturbing events in their farmhouse in Rhode Island in 1971. The Warrens find themselves caught in the most horrifying case of their lives. The family is tormented by a dark presence in the form of a malicious spirit who has latched onto their home. With the help of the Warrens, the Perrons are able to uncover the mystery of the spirit and attempt to expel it from their home. The Conjuring is a chilling and suspenseful horror film that is sure to keep viewers on the edge of their seats.
